Transaction dba2833bd7cf779d643b1bd8e2aecd2f573f3473d912faa2f2df0dcd47e799ab

block
63db39b4ef365d4c40a64746a5449077b7381e360faef3fbad1f1ca4a17e2ca1

1 Input

24 Outputs